Posts

Showing posts with the label BPMN User Task

🇫🇷 Camunda 8 – Human Task Job Worker et PropriĂ©tĂ©s : Guide Complet avec Exemples

Image
Dans Camunda 8 , la gestion des tâches humaines (Human Tasks / User Tasks) est totalement diffĂ©rente de Camunda 7. Il n’y a pas de moteur embarquĂ© , pas de Java Delegates , et pas de logique Tasklist intĂ©grĂ©e au moteur . Camunda 8 repose sur Zeebe , un moteur de workflow distribuĂ©, cloud-native et orientĂ© Ă©vĂ©nements , oĂą les Job Workers orchestrent l’exĂ©cution des tâches — y compris le cycle de vie des tâches humaines . Ce guide explique : ✔ Le fonctionnement des Human Tasks dans Camunda 8 ✔ Le rĂ´le du Human Task Job Worker ✔ Toutes les propriĂ©tĂ©s importantes d’une Human Task ✔ L’assignation, la complĂ©tion et les variables ✔ Les diffĂ©rences avec Camunda 7 ✔ Les bonnes pratiques et un exemple rĂ©el ⭐ 1. Fonctionnement des Human Tasks dans Camunda 8 (Vue globale) Dans Camunda 8, le flux est le suivant : Une User Task BPMN est atteinte Le moteur Zeebe crĂ©e un job de type Human Task La Tasklist affiche la tâche aux utilisateurs L’utilisateur claim (optionnel) ...

Camunda 8 Human Task Job Worker – Complete Guide with Properties & Examples

Image
Camunda 8 Human Task Job Worker – Complete Guide with Properties & Examples In Camunda 8 , Human Tasks are implemented very differently from Camunda 7. There is no embedded engine , no Java Delegates, and no direct Tasklist logic inside the engine. Instead, Camunda 8 is built on Zeebe , a distributed, event-driven workflow engine , where job workers are responsible for executing work—including Human Task lifecycle management . This blog explains: ✔ How Human Tasks work in Camunda 8 ✔ What a Human Task Job Worker is ✔ All-important Human Task properties ✔ Assignment, completion, and variables ✔ Differences from Camunda 7 ✔ Best practices and real-world examples ⭐ 1. How Human Tasks Work in Camunda 8 (Big Picture) In Camunda 8: A User Task in BPMN creates a Human Task job The Tasklist application interacts with the engine Workers handle lifecycle events (create, claim, complete) The workflow continues only after the task is completed ⚠️ Important: Hum...

🇫🇷 CrĂ©er une Tasklist entièrement personnalisĂ©e pour Camunda 7 avec Angular ou React – Guide Complet

Image
De nombreuses entreprises ne souhaitent pas utiliser la Tasklist par dĂ©faut de Camunda 7. Elles ont besoin d’une interface : ✔ Moderne (React, Angular, Vue) ✔ Totalement personnalisĂ©e (UI, couleurs, menus) ✔ IntĂ©grĂ©e Ă  leur portail interne ✔ SĂ©curisĂ©e (JWT, Keycloak, OAuth2) ✔ Mobile-friendly ✔ AdaptĂ©e aux rĂ´les mĂ©tier Dans cette approche, Camunda reste le moteur de workflow , tandis que votre application front-end devient une Tasklist personnalisĂ©e . ⭐ Pourquoi crĂ©er une Tasklist personnalisĂ©e ? ✔ UI conforme Ă  la charte graphique ✔ ExpĂ©rience utilisateur moderne ✔ IntĂ©gration dans un portail existant ✔ Tableaux de bord, statistiques, SLA ✔ Interface par rĂ´le : employĂ©, manager, superviseur ✔ Compatible mobile ✔ Plus de flexibilitĂ© que Tasklist (AngularJS obsolète) C’est la solution standard pour des portails professionnels. ⭐ Architecture gĂ©nĂ©rale L’utilisateur se connecte Ă  votre application Angular/React Votre UI appelle les API REST de Camunda L’int...

Camunda 7 Tasklist Customization – Complete Guide with Examples

Image
Camunda Tasklist is the built-in web application used to manage User Tasks inside Camunda 7. By default, it offers a simple UI for completing tasks — but many real-world systems need: ✔ Branding / Company colors ✔ Custom login pages ✔ Custom header & footer ✔ Custom forms ✔ Custom task filters ✔ Buttons, scripts, or plugins ✔ Integration with your own front-end This guide explains everything you can customize in Camunda Tasklist , with examples, best practices, and recommended approaches. ⭐ What Can You Customize in Tasklist? Camunda 7 Tasklist allows customization in three layers: 1️⃣ Look & Feel (Branding & UI) Colors Logos CSS styles Header/Footer Layout 2️⃣ Behaviour (Add JS, Buttons, Actions) Custom scripts Additional buttons External redirects Dynamic task field behaviour 3️⃣ Forms (UI for User Tasks) Camunda Forms Embedded Forms External Forms (your own UI) ⭐ 1. Customizing Tasklist Theme (CSS + Branding)...